Public Parking | Structure in Motion
Year: 2017 | Project type: Public parking building | Role: Architectural visualization | Architect: KAYAN | Client: KAYAN
Public Parking turns an infrastructure program into a clear expression of movement and light. The daylight visualization reveals sculptural ramps, concrete structure and a permeable mesh façade at street level, while the night view traces circulation with colored illumination and gives the building a distinctive urban identity. Together, the two images explain function and atmosphere without disguising the directness of the parking structure. M. Mostafa created the architectural visualization in 2017 for KAYAN, credited as architect and client. The project demonstrates how infrastructure and exterior visualization can make circulation, visibility and public presence immediately legible.
